What if I can't complete 50,000 words?
That's okay! 

If you participate and end up with 20,000 or even 10,000 words written - that's a win!  You'll still be an important part of the community. We'll simply encourage you to repeat your progress in December, and again in January ... we all have our own processes and timelines.

But clear goals and the power of community often push us to accomplish more than we imagine!

Books are largely edited into publication. But they have to be written, first! 
Too many writers try to edit while they write, and end up feeling frustrated or stuck.

Abbie and Libby provide a supportive path through the generative phase with gentle guidance towards the essential story fundamentals phase.
